About Church of the Blessed Sacrament

Church of the Blessed Sacrament - Colonia Del Sacramento | Secret World Trip Planner

The Blessed Sacrament Church is one of the main attractions in Colonia del Sacramento. The church is one of the oldest in the city, having been built by the Portuguese in 1680.The Blessed Sacrament Church is located within the old city of Cologne, surrounded by cobblestone streets and colonial buildings. The façade of the church is Baroque in style and features a series of statues representing religious figures. The interior of the church is equally spectacular, with a coffered ceiling and numerous paintings depicting biblical scenes.One of the highlights of the church is the high altar, which was made of carved and gilded wood. The altar is richly decorated with statues of saints and cherubs, and has been considered one of the most important works of art in the city.Another interesting feature of the Blessed Sacrament Church is the bell tower, which is located next to the church. The bell tower was built in 1808 and houses a bell that has been used for centuries to signal the start of masses and church services.The Blessed Sacrament Church was restored in the 1970s and now hosts a variety of cultural and religious events, including classical music concerts and special church services during religious holidays.In summary, Blessed Sacrament Church is one of the main attractions in Colonia del Sacramento, thanks to its spectacular architecture and ancient history.
